Malachy
11-12-2008, 04:56 PM
I made a thread about this a few weeks ago dubbing it one of the best online games ever. www.footballsuperstars.com (http://www.footballsuperstars.com) explains it more but the reason I'm posting it again is because if you signed up and put yourself in the 'Transfer Window' you will now be able to PLAY Football Superstars. Everyone who put themselves in the transfer window has now been sent the e-mail to download the game. I'm half way through my download now, can't wait.
Anyone else got the download?
Anyone else got the download?